What companies run services between Manistee, MI, USA and Kenosha, WI, USA?

There is no direct connection from Manistee to Kenosha. However, you can drive to Muskegon, take the car ferry to Milwaukee, then drive to Kenosha.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Reed City, MI, take the bus to Grand Rapids, MI, walk to Grand Rapids Vernon J. Ehlers Station, take the train to Chicago Union Station, walk to Clinton & Quincy, take the line 124 bus to Washington & Canal, walk to Chicago OTC, then take the train to Kenosha.
